The Vital Role of Solder Paste Printers in Electronics Manufacturing
In the rapidly evolving world of electronics manufacturing, solder paste printers have become indispensable tools that enhance efficiency and precision in the assembly of printed circuit boards (PCBs). These machines automate the process of applying solder paste, a mixture of tiny solder balls and flux, to specific areas on a PCB, ensuring that components are securely attached during the soldering process.
What Makes Solder Paste Printers Essential?
Efficiency and Speed: One of the primary advantages of solder paste printers is their ability to significantly increase production speed. By automating the paste application, manufacturers can achieve higher throughput, which is crucial for meeting tight production schedules. This increased efficiency not only accelerates the assembly process but also allows for the scaling of production to meet growing demand.
Precision and Accuracy: Solder paste printers are designed to apply solder paste with high precision. This accuracy is vital in electronics manufacturing, where even the slightest misalignment can lead to defects and product failures. Advanced printers utilize sophisticated vision systems to ensure that the paste is applied exactly where it is needed, reducing the risk of errors.
Cost Reduction: Automating the solder paste application process leads to significant cost savings. By minimizing labor costs and reducing material waste, manufacturers can improve their profit margins. Additionally, the consistency provided by these machines helps to lower the rate of defects, further contributing to cost efficiency.
Quality Control: Modern solder paste printers often come equipped with advanced inspection systems that monitor the paste application in real time. This capability allows manufacturers to identify and address potential issues early in the production process, ensuring that only high-quality products reach the market.
Flexibility: Many solder paste printers are designed to handle a variety of PCB sizes and configurations. This adaptability is essential for manufacturers who need to respond quickly to changing product demands and market trends.
